Robotic phrasing versus human phrasing
| Context | What the model writes | What a person writes |
|---|---|---|
| Sales | Drove revenue growth through strategic initiatives. | Grew pipeline from $400K to $1.2M by calling 40 leads a week. |
| Support | Delivered exceptional customer experiences. | Cut average ticket time from 9 hours to 3 by rewriting the help docs. |
| Marketing | Used data to optimize campaign performance. | Killed two ad sets and shifted budget, lifting ROAS by 22%. |
How to make ChatGPT sound human
- 1Rewrite the prompt first
Tell it to write in a specific tone and ban its favorite words. A prompt that says "avoid the words delve, tapestry, and crucial, and take a clear position" already removes half the tells.
- 2Replace the generic opener
Start each bullet with a verb, add a number, and show the method. Trade adjectives for outcomes, since recruiters skim past the adjectives anyway.
- 3Add something the model could not invent
Insert a personal example, a screenshot, or a number from your own work. Anything sourced from your hands breaks the generic pattern.
- 4Cut the wrap-up and the hedges
Delete summary lines that repeat the point and qualifiers that soften every claim. Trust a single clear statement over a hedged one.
